In an ordinary street, close to Bruce Grove Station, hidden beneath a row of late 19th century housing, lies an ancient relic of Tottenham’s past.

You may have walked past without a second glance, scarcely noticing the road name, or perhaps even wondered who is St Loy? Here is meant to be a holy well, given a French saint’s name.

Where is the well now? And what on earth do horses have to do with it?
